What Are Biosurfactants?

Biosurfactants are molecules produced by bacteria, yeast, and fungi that act as natural surface-active agents. They help reduce surface tension between liquids and solids, making them excellent at:

  • Cleaning – Breaking down grease and dirt.

  • Emulsifying – Mixing oil and water.

  • Foaming – Creating stable lather in soaps and shampoos.

Unlike chemical surfactants (like SLS and SLES), biosurfactants are:
✅ Biodegradable – They decompose naturally without harming the environment.
✅ Non-toxic – Safe for humans, animals, and marine life.
✅ Renewable – Made from natural sources like plant sugars and microbes.


How Are Biosurfactants Made?

Biosurfactants are produced through microbial fermentation, where bacteria or fungi are grown in controlled environments with nutrient-rich feedstocks (like sugarcane or vegetable oils). The microbes secrete biosurfactants as part of their metabolic processes.

Key Production Methods:

  1. Submerged Fermentation – Microbes grow in liquid nutrient broth.

  2. Solid-State Fermentation – Uses agricultural waste (like rice husks) as a growth medium.

  3. Genetic Engineering – Scientists modify microbes to produce biosurfactants more efficiently.

Because they rely on natural processes, biosurfactants have a much lower environmental impact than petroleum-based surfactants.

Real-World Applications

🌿 Green Cleaning Products

Companies like Ecover and Seventh Generation use biosurfactants in their eco-friendly detergents.

🛢️ Oil Spill Remediation

Rhamnolipids (a type of biosurfactant) help clean marine oil spills faster than chemical dispersants.

🍞 Food & Beverage Industry

Used in baking, dairy, and processed foods to improve texture and shelf life.

💊 Pharmaceuticals

  • Lipopeptides fight antibiotic-resistant bacteria.

  • Used in nanomedicine for targeted drug delivery.


Challenges & The Future

Current Limitations:

  • Higher production costs than synthetic surfactants.

  • Limited large-scale availability.

Future Innovations:

🔬 Cheaper production methods (using food waste as feedstock).
🌍 Government policies promoting biosurfactant use.
🛒 Increased consumer demand for green products.

Experts predict the biosurfactant market will grow by 5.5% annually, reaching $2.8 billion by 2027.
